Overview
ACEC Wild Rose Pump is an operational substation in the United States, operating at 69 kV. It plays a role in regional electrical distribution and grid stability.
ACEC Wild Rose Pump is a substation located in the United States, with coordinates 44.146893, -89.267735. It operates at a voltage of 69 kV, which is typical for sub-transmission or distribution-level infrastructure, supporting local grid connectivity and power flow management. The substation operates under the regulatory framework of the United States, which includes NERC reliability standards and FERC oversight for transmission assets. At 69 kV, it likely serves as a distribution substation, stepping down voltage for local consumption or connecting to smaller industrial or municipal loads. The facility is classified as operational, indicating active grid integration. As part of the electrical infrastructure, ACEC Wild Rose Pump contributes to the reliability of power supply in its region. Its location in a rural or semi-urban area of Wisconsin suggests it supports agricultural, residential, or light industrial demand. The substation's role in voltage regulation and load balancing is critical for maintaining grid stability and preventing outages.
